A moving clock ticks slow. dt = γ·dτ — the coordinate time between two ticks of a clock whose own proper time is dτ. Because γ>1 for any motion, the muon born high in the atmosphere lives long enough, in ground time, to reach the ground. Rendered, not quoted.
Two events on one worldline — tick, then tock — are separated by proper time dτ in the clock's own rest frame (same place, so only time differs). In a frame where that clock moves at speed v, the two events are at different places, and the coordinate time between them is
Since γ>1 whenever v>0, the moving clock's dτ is squeezed into a larger ground interval dt: fewer ticks per second of ground time — it runs slow. At v=0, γ=1 and dt=dτ.
Moving clocks run slow — Einstein 1905, §4. dt = γ dτ is the time component of the-lorentz-transformation, reciprocal with the-length-contraction (L = L₀/γ), and the reason the-twin-paradox is real once one twin accelerates.

Muon, γ=10, proper lifetime τ: ground lifetime = 10τ; distance travelled ≈ 9.9499 τc — far enough to reach sea level, which at rest it never could.
"If it's all relative, the OTHER frame sees YOUR clock slow too — so who is really slow? The whole thing is a contradiction."
Answer: both are right, and there is no contradiction. Dilation is symmetric because it depends on relative velocity only. The apparent paradox is resolved only by adding a real, frame-independent event — a reunion, which requires acceleration (the-twin-paradox). Symmetry of the effect ≠ symmetry of the histories.
